On Mon, 9 Jun 2008 14:21:51 +0200 (CEST) Julia Lawall <[EMAIL PROTECTED]> wrote: > > From: Julia Lawall <[EMAIL PROTECTED]> > > of_node_put is needed before discarding a value received from > of_find_node_by_name, eg in error handling code. > > The semantic patch that makes the change is as follows: > (http://www.emn.fr/x-info/coccinelle/) > > // <smpl> > @@ > struct device_node *n; > struct device_node *n1; > statement S; > identifier f; > expression E; > constant C; > @@ > > n = of_find_node_by_name(...) > ... > if (!n) S > ... when != of_node_put(n) > when != n1 = f(n,...) > when != E = n > when any > when strict > ( > + of_node_put(n); > return -C; > | > of_node_put(n); > | > n1 = f(n,...) > | > E = n > | > return ...; > ) > // </smpl> > > Signed-off-by: Julia Lawall <[EMAIL PROTECTED]>
